Convicted Terrorist Jailed in UK For Dark Web Bitcoin Trading

Convicted terrorist Khuram Iqbal, a 29-year-old British national, has been jailed for 16 months after trading cryptocurrencies on the dark web, per the BBC.  This is not the first time Iqbal has faced jail time. In 2014, he was jailed for disseminating terrorist publications, and possessing terrorist information—including al-Qaeda’s Inspire magazine.  At the time, he was jailed for three years…

Central Bank of Argentina Scrutinizes Companies Offering ‘Extraordinary Returns’ on Crypto Asset Investments – Bitcoin News

The Central Bank of Argentina has announced it is making inquiries regarding cryptocurrency investment companies. Specifically, the bank stated they are investigating companies that are offering extraordinary returns with cryptocurrency investments, which are not reasonable. These companies could be operating as Ponzi schemes, according to the bank, and it is currently examining the possibility of taking legal action against them.…
